That would work but you could just as easily configure all the workstations NOT to do the install (there is an app on the Microsoft site that will prevent the install even if a computer does download SP2). Then download the network install and do a manual install on a few computers to run your tests on. This way you have control over when the SP2 install happens and can watch for conflicts during the install, if there are any. If you find no issues with the software you use, you can do a roll out on a wider scale either with the auto-update or continue to use the network install you have downloaded.
